I'll post the links later ( I have them on my home PC). I ordered ripstop nylon from PCT Fabrics for $3 a yard.
I also came across a site with 2.2 lbs of 750 fill down for $150. I know other sites have 800 or even 900 fill down. But when I worked the cost to weight saving, it did not seem worth it to spend about twice as much to save 5+ oz.
